Default ASUS unveils budget X102BA laptop with 10-point touch and AMD inside

ASUS' new Zenbook UX301 and second-gen Transformer Book a little too rich for your blood? You'll be glad to hear that the company has announced what appears to be a more down-to-Earth ultraportable, the X102BA. As suggested in rumors, the laptop is ultimately a rival to Acer's 11-inch Aspire V5. While the X102BA sports a smaller 10.1-inch touchscreen, it uses the same 1GHz Temash-based AMD processor and should offer both healthy battery life and quicker-than-usual integrated graphics. The base 2GB of RAM and 320GB hard drive won't impress anyone, but ASUS is sweetening the pot by offering a free copy of Office 2013 Home & Student with every model. The company isn't providing launch details just yet; still, we wouldn't be surprised if the X102BA is priced well within the budgets of returning students.
